Jay Z Turns Out To See New NFL Client Dallas Cowboy's Dez Bryant

Jay Z is always confident and making excellent business decisions. Jay Z's sports management company, Roc Nation Sports, just signed Dallas Cowboy's Wide receiver, Dez Bryant. This could prove to be another successful business endeavor for the rapper-turned-mogul. Bryant wants to be respected about his 10-year deal that averages $12 million per year and includes only 20 million in guaranteed money. Regardless of the deal, Jay Z was still at the Metlife Stadium to support Bryant during his game agianst the Giants.

Bryant is clearly doing something right to be drawing so much attention...and bringing in so much money. NBC reported on Bryant's possible deal, and the strife he is dealing with:

"[Initially] the Cowboys offered Bryant a 10-year, $114 million deal, with only $20 million guaranteed. Now, it appears the Cowboys have opted for hardball, launching a P.R. attack against Bryant and in turn making potential suitors think twice about pursuing Bryant, who would be far better off forcing the Cowboys to use the franchise tag on a year-to-year basis than accepting a deal that gives him some security up front but ties him to the team for as long as the team chooses to keep him.

Even with that said, it didn't stop Jay Z from turning out to support his new client. Also, according to TMZ it didn't hinder Bryant's ability:

"Jay Z hit up MetLife Stadium to watch his newest client, Dez Bryant, tear up the NY Giants...Jay's Roc Nation Sports just signed #88 ... and Dez couldn't be happier about it -- throwing up the Roc Nation sign after both of his touchdowns last night...Dez is reportedly gunning for one of the biggest contracts in NFL history ... something over the $100 million mark ... and after last night's performance, ya gotta think Jay's more confident than ever that he'll get it."
